Donating Non-Running Cars in Walnut Creek

A car that no longer starts is one of the worst things to try to sell — buyers steeply discount for the unknowns, and tow costs come out of the seller's pocket. The vehicle still owes registration, though, and most policies require some kind of insurance even on a parked car.

Qualified charities accept non-running vehicles directly. Towing is included at no cost, the title transfers at pickup, and the IRS Form 1098-C arrives once the charity processes the vehicle. The owner is rid of the car and the costs that came with it in a single appointment.

What Walnut Creek Donors Ask About Car Donation

Straight answers on donating your car, the tax treatment, and what to expect.

Can a business, LLC, or trust donate a vehicle in Walnut Creek? expand_more

Yes. Vehicles held by a company, partnership, or trust can be donated, though the deduction rules differ from those for individuals. An entity considering a gift should review the specifics with its tax advisor.

Can a car with a lien be donated in Walnut Creek? expand_more

Generally only after the lien is paid off and the lender has released the title. Donating a vehicle with an active lien creates legal complications because the lender, not the registered owner, technically controls the title.

What does a charity do with a donated Walnut Creek car? expand_more

Most charities sell donated vehicles — at auction, through a partner dealer, or directly — and direct the proceeds to their programs. Some charities use a donated car directly for fleet or client transportation. The receiving charity can confirm its intended use before pickup.

Who handles the paperwork and title transfer? expand_more

The donor signs the vehicle title over to the charity at the time of pickup; the receiving charity files the transfer with the state and mails the IRS Form 1098-C afterwards. Specific signature requirements vary by state DMV.

Does the make or model of the Walnut Creek car matter? expand_more

Almost any make is accepted — domestic, import, and luxury vehicles are all routinely donated. Acceptance is driven more by title status, location, and condition than by brand.

What types of vehicles qualify for donation? expand_more

Cars, trucks, SUVs, minivans, motorcycles, RVs, boats on trailers, jet skis, ATVs, and snowmobiles are all commonly accepted. Acceptance of unusual vehicles is confirmed by the receiving charity when pickup is scheduled.
